The Science Behind Glucose and Insulin

Before delving into the specifics of black coffee’s impact on glucose levels, it’s crucial to understand some fundamental concepts regarding glucose and insulin.

What is Glucose?

Glucose is a simple sugar that serves as the primary energy source for the body’s cells. It is vital for normal bodily functions and comes from various foods we consume, especially carbohydrates.

What Role Does Insulin Play?

Insulin is a hormone produced by the pancreas that helps regulate blood glucose levels. When we eat, glucose enters the bloodstream, prompting the pancreas to release insulin, which facilitates the transport of glucose into the cells. Inadequate insulin production or poor insulin sensitivity can lead to elevated blood glucose levels, a hallmark of conditions such as prediabetes and type 2 diabetes.

Black Coffee and Its Influence on Glucose Levels

The effect of black coffee on glucose metabolism has been the topic of numerous studies, with conflicting results. Here, we highlight some of the most significant findings.

Studies Supporting Positive Effects

Several studies suggest that black coffee may have a protective effect on glucose levels. Some of the key studies include:

  1. A 2014 study published in the journal Diabetes Care found that regular coffee consumption was associated with a lower risk of type 2 diabetes. This study highlighted that participants who consumed more than six cups of coffee daily had a 22% reduced risk of developing the disease compared to those who consumed none.

  2. Another Nutritional Journal study examined the connection between black coffee consumption and improved insulin sensitivity. The findings indicated that chlorogenic acids in coffee could help regulate blood sugar by slowing glucose absorption from the intestine.

Contradictory Evidence

While many studies highlight the benefits of black coffee, some research presents contradictory evidence:

  1. A study published in the American Journal of Clinical Nutrition revealed that acute coffee consumption could temporarily raise blood glucose levels in certain individuals. This effect may be exacerbated by the caffeine content, which can cause a spike in cortisol, a hormone that raises glucose levels.

  2. Another research pointed out that the effect of coffee on glucose levels might vary based on genetic predispositions, tolerance levels to caffeine, and individual metabolic responses.

Understanding the Mechanisms at Play

To grasp how black coffee affects glucose levels, we must delve into the mechanisms involved, particularly focusing on caffeine and other coffee compounds.

The Role of Caffeine

Caffeine, the most renowned component of coffee, has been shown to have a dual effect on glucose metabolism:

  • Short-term effects: Caffeine can promote alertness and boost energy levels. However, it may also induce a temporary rise in blood glucose levels by stimulating the release of adrenaline, which encourages the liver to release stored glucose.

  • Long-term effects: Regular coffee drinkers may develop tolerance to the glucose-raising effects of caffeine. Over time, the body becomes more efficient at processing glucose, leading to enhanced insulin sensitivity.

Chlorogenic Acids and Antioxidants

Beyond caffeine, black coffee is rich in chlorogenic acids, which have been shown to have anti-diabetic properties. These compounds may aid in:

  • Slowing the absorption of glucose in the digestive tract.
  • Reducing the glucose output from the liver.
  • Enhancing insulin sensitivity.

By improving how our bodies handle glucose, these compounds may help reduce the risk of developing type 2 diabetes over time.

Practical Recommendations for Coffee Drinkers

So, how can regular coffee consumption fit into a balanced approach to managing glucose levels? Here are some guidelines and practical tips:

1. Moderation is Key

While coffee may provide benefits, moderation is crucial. Studies generally suggest that 3 to 4 cups per day is a safe and beneficial amount for most adults. Excessive consumption may lead to increased adrenaline levels, resulting in higher blood glucose.

2. Monitor Individual Responses

Everyone’s body reacts differently to caffeine. Keep track of how your body responds to coffee, especially if you have preexisting conditions like diabetes. Consider conducting glucose tests before and after coffee consumption to gain insights into your personal glucose response.

3. Avoid Additives

Adding sugar, cream, or flavored syrups can significantly alter the impact of coffee on glucose levels. Stick to black coffee to reap its benefits while maintaining low-caloric intake.

4. Consult with Healthcare Professionals

If you have concerns about your glucose levels, it’s best to consult with a healthcare provider or a registered dietitian. They can offer personalized advice and recommendations tailored to your needs.

What compounds in black coffee affect glucose levels?

Black coffee contains various bioactive compounds, including caffeine, chlorogenic acids, and other antioxidants, which may play roles in influencing glucose metabolism. Caffeine is known for its stimulant effects and could temporarily increase blood sugar levels by reducing insulin sensitivity. This reaction can be pronounced in individuals who are more sensitive to caffeine or have pre-existing metabolic conditions.

Chlorogenic acids, on the other hand, have been shown to have a more beneficial impact on glucose metabolism. These compounds may slow down the absorption of carbohydrates in the bloodstream and improve insulin sensitivity. This dual action highlights the complexity of black coffee’s impact on glucose levels, underscoring the need for further research to completely understand how it affects people with different metabolic profiles.

How does drinking black coffee before a meal affect glucose levels?

Drinking black coffee before a meal can influence postprandial (after eating) glucose levels, primarily due to its caffeine content. Some studies have indicated that consuming black coffee prior to eating may lead to higher blood sugar spikes compared to having no coffee. The mechanism behind this effect may involve the inhibitory action of caffeine on insulin secretion, which is essential for regulating glucose uptake after a meal.

However, it is crucial to note that the effect of black coffee before meals can vary significantly among individuals. For some people, black coffee may help improve insulin sensitivity, potentially leading to lower overall blood sugar responses. Therefore, individual responses to coffee consumption before meals can differ based on metabolic health, caffeine tolerance, and dietary habits.

How does decaf coffee compare to regular black coffee in terms of glucose levels?

Decaffeinated coffee, or decaf, has much of its caffeine removed but still contains several beneficial compounds like antioxidants. When comparing decaf coffee to regular black coffee regarding glucose levels, research has shown that decaf may not have the same stimulating effects on blood sugar levels as regular coffee. This could make decaf a better option for those who are sensitive to caffeine’s effects on glucose.

Some studies also suggest that decaf may provide some benefits related to glucose metabolism and insulin sensitivity without the spikes usually associated with caffeine. However, more research is needed to fully elucidate the differences in effects between regular and decaf coffee. Individual responses may vary, so it’s important for consumers to observe how each type of coffee affects their blood sugar levels.
